Playstyle

Overview

Hector is a Tier VIII Commonwealth cruiser built around the super-heal: each Repair Party charge returns dramatically more HP than a standard heal, so her durability comes from sustain rather than armor. Sonar (5.6 km on ships and 3.8 km on torpedoes, 100 s active, 180 s reload, long uptime) lights up DDs and torpedoes inside its bubble, which lets her contest the cap edge without taking the spotting cycle. Standout traits: best smoke duration in T8 CAs (90 s) and top-decile repairs citadel hits in T8 CAs (50).

Positioning

Hold 12-15 km where rotated focus can find island cover within one heal cycle. The super-heal (~2%/s, roughly twice a standard heal) makes sustained trades profitable that would not be on a standard cruiser, but only if you finish the trade behind cover; open-water sustain just feeds shells. Your guns lose penetration at range, so aim AP at broadsides you can still citadel and put HE into superstructures and upper-hull sections, rather than the bow-in or belt armor your shells bounce and shatter on. Shooting from the cloud gives you away at 4.2 km, and a destroyer here is spotted at about 7 km, so you see it coming with roughly 2.8 km to spare. Vision is mutual: past the 2 km guaranteed ring you cannot see out either, and only your Sonar bubble (5.6 km) sees out; past that you are shooting at what a teammate holds lit. Enemy sonar (about 4.7 km) and radar (about 9 km) read straight in regardless.

Potato Avoidance

Trading the super-heal advantage in open water

The kit rewards finishing the trade behind cover so the heal recovers what the salvo took; sustained open-water exposure burns through all 2 charges before the cooldown completes.

Effective HP
ƒBase 34,400 HP plus everything Repair Party can restore: 2%/s x 20 s = 13,760 HP per charge, x2 charges = 27,520 HP. Ceiling, not a prediction: a charge only restores damage actually taken, and only the regeneratable share of it. Across 1,826 players in our replay corpus the median ship realized about half of this, mostly because half the charges go unspent — when Repair Party IS pressed it returns ~97% of the per-charge figure above.
61,920

Armor Beta

Hull HP 34,400, distributed across 5 hull zones, each with its own plate thicknesses, saturation cap, and pen thresholds. HP caps are the exact in-game values, not estimated.

Bow & stern16 mm

Overmatched by 139+ AP guns across the bracket. Can’t reliably bow-tank; gets bow-citadelled and overpenned.

Belt / citadel114 mm

Thin belt: battleship AP citadels straight through it broadside. Rely on angle, speed and concealment, never sit flat.

Farming13 mm

Superstructure and extremities take HE pens and AP overpens from nearly any gun: steady chip damage. Fire resistance 40%, fires burn 30s. Range-by-range in the Compare tool →

Saturation cap = HP a section can absorb before further damage to it is reduced (the "bow-tank" effect). Citadel pool is ~165k on every ship (effectively no cap); damage is gated by pen/over-pen multipliers instead. Superstructure saturates fast but HE always pens regardless of the plate thickness. Rudder (and other module HPs) are a separate pool from ship HP: damaging a module doesn't drain ship HP. Incapacitated modules like the rudder and engine are restored by DCP, but secondary and AA mounts destroyed at 0 HP stay out for the rest of the battle.
